GTMC names new chairman
The GTMC has appointed Paul Allan, chairman of Ian Allan Travel, as its new chairman.
Graham Ramsey, CEO of the ATPI Group, becomes immediate past chairman, Mervyn Williamson, joint managing director of Statesman Travel Group, continues as treasurer, and Anthony Rissbrook, managing director Hillgate Travel, is appointed as officer.
Each will work in an advisory capacity to CEO Paul Wait and will support the strategic direction and positioning of the organisation, which is in its 50th year.
The new board appointments will see the GTMC board extended to 14 people and includes seven new members.
